Sky Sports News will host an interactive Liverpool quiz on Sky Sports News and Main Event tonight.

Sky Sports News created history two weeks ago by hosting its first interactive Premier League quiz, and are following it up with a quiz on the newly-crowned Premier League champions, comprising of season trivia, goals, transfers, Jurgen Klopp's key games and a round on 1989/90.

Hosted by Sky Sports News presenters Jules Warren and Jo Wilson, it couldn't be easier to take part as viewers will be able to play along using their mobile phones (visit skysports.com/play for more details).

Updated quiz explainer

Consisting of five rounds of five questions (all multiple choice), players will be given 15 seconds to answer each question on Liverpool's season.

Each answer is scored by points - the longer you take, the more your score goes down with a maximum of 1,000 points available per question.

Klopp's 10 steps to greatness

Jurgen Klopp took over Liverpool in 10th place in the Premier League. Through maverick decision-making, masterful motivating and tactical dexterity, he's made them England's best.

But it's been a ride. Three cup final defeats in two-and-a-half years had many questioning his steel when it mattered, and Pep Guardiola's Manchester City had kept them second-best domestically. Now Liverpool have been crowned champions for the first time in 30 years, and they're tumbling records along the way.

A squad transformation has played a part, but there is much more behind Klopp's influence at Anfield. Subtle technical changes, attitude shifts and behind-the-scenes genius have made them unstoppable.
